Richard T. Bumby is a scholar working on Computational Theory and Mathematics, Mathematical Physics and Algebra and Number Theory. According to data from OpenAlex, Richard T. Bumby has authored 17 papers receiving a total of 267 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 6 papers in Computational Theory and Mathematics, 6 papers in Mathematical Physics and 5 papers in Algebra and Number Theory. Recurrent topics in Richard T. Bumby’s work include Mathematical Dynamics and Fractals (3 papers), semigroups and automata theory (3 papers) and Algebraic Geometry and Number Theory (3 papers). Richard T. Bumby is often cited by papers focused on Mathematical Dynamics and Fractals (3 papers), semigroups and automata theory (3 papers) and Algebraic Geometry and Number Theory (3 papers). Richard T. Bumby collaborates with scholars based in United States and The Netherlands. Richard T. Bumby's co-authors include Eduardo D. Sontag, Erik Ellentuck, H.J. Sussmann, David E. Dobbs and W.V Vasconcelos and has published in prestigious journals such as American Mathematical Monthly, Advances in Mathematics and Systems & Control Letters.
